Common questions about trade in Borth
How many businesses import or export from Borth?
HMRC customs records show 5 businesses in Borth (SY24) filed declarations over the last six months — 24 import declarations and 2 export declarations in total. This page is rebuilt every 24 hours as new HMRC data is published.

Is trade from Borth growing?
Import activity is down 11.1% compared with the previous six months. Our model, which reads two years of monthly history, expects the next three months to rise by roughly 22.2%. That figure is our estimate, not an HMRC projection.
